A Critical Resource for the Security Industry

Security consultants, or security specifiers, serve a critical role in the physical security industry.  Challenged with the task of simultaneously managing projects in all vertical markets across multiple geographies, they provide invaluable guidance and direction, helping end users meet their project needs and goals. 

Recognizing the importance of their contribution to the security industry as a whole, HID established a program and dedicated team to better serve security consultants and their clients.
